Utilization of micro fines in iron and steel making process

A huge quantity of iron oxides fines (60 % of ore) are generated in mines area and in different units of steel plants. Coarser sizes of these are used in sinter plant. However in sintering, there is some restriction of using micro fines. It is possible to use in pelletization, but pelletization is a cost intensive process due to its high temperature curing.

Commercial utilization of waste/low-grade iron ore fines in SAIL mines

The use of high-quality iron ore, leaving out low-quality overburden, has resulted in huge accumulation of dumped rejects over the years. Due to limited beneficiation facilities available at SAIL mines the accumulated stockpiles of so-called waste dumps are consuming lot of space, putting pressure on environment and creating pollution hazard.

Innovative Development on Agglomeration of Iron Ore Fines

In steel industry and in mines, a significant amount of ultra-fines waste iron oxides and iron ore fines is generated. Utilizations of these fines are required to reduce the environmental hazards and conserve the natural resources. Some of these fines are normally used in sintering practice. However, sintering has a limitation of accepting ultra-fines materials.

Adverse effects on environment by the Iron Ore Industries

Singhbhum-Orissa iron ore belt in the eastern India has abundant reserves of iron ore in the form of horse shoe belt. The soft laminated ore, goethitic-lateritic ores, friable ore and blue dust abundantly occur-in this region and are very soft and friable in nature: Large amount of fines and slimes arc generated during mining, washing, crushing ...

Beneficiation of iron ore fines to improve blast furnace

The popular technologies available for beneficiation are washing of iron ore and jigging of ore. Iron ore from our captive mines contains high alumina content of around of 2.3% and has been major obstacles in lowering slag rate. Alumina in iron ore fines affects the process of sintering and quality of sinter.

Development of hematite ore pellet utilizing mill scale and iron ore …

Iron ore slime is generated from mines during processing and washing of iron ore, and it is not considered for pelletizing due to its excessive fineness and high gangue content, despite its good green bonding property. Mill scale is generated from steel rolling mills and reheating furnaces; it has almost nil gangue content, but is not individually considered for …

Beneficiation of Iron ore Fines from Large Deposits of

About 20 million tonnes of low grade iron ore fines have been accumulated and stacked over the years as 'Dump Rejects' in the Gua iron ore mine of Bihar and about 8 million tonnes of generated fines are stacked in the Dalli Iron Ore Mine, M.P., under operation by Steel Authority of India Ltd., (SAIL).
